## Step 4: Load Test the Checkout Flow

Before enabling your plugin on Cartwheel's production tier, run a sustained load test against the sandbox checkout endpoint. Use at least 200 concurrent virtual shoppers for 15 minutes, and watch for latency spikes above 800 ms during the payment-capture phase. Throttle limits differ per plugin tier, so verify yours first. Apply the following configuration values to your test harness before starting.

deployment values, faduf-tawep:
SORDOR_LOG_LEVEL=error
SORDOR_METRICS_HOST=metrics.sordor.nelvrolabs.internal
SORDOR_POOL_SIZE=4

## Artifact Signing — Tallyvane Sidecar

All Tallyvane metrics-aggregation sidecar images are signed during the package stage and verified by the admission hook before rollout. Unsigned images are rejected cluster-wide as of this week. Rotation happens monthly; the previous key stays valid for a 48-hour overlap. The sidecar's current signing key is listed below.

signing key of bagap-yawep = bky13_TbfT6ZMUoGJo2

Plugin authors extending the Willowgate clinic reminder job: please don't hardcode send windows in your hook. The scheduler already enforces quiet hours and per-patient rate limits, and duplicating that logic caused the double-text incident at the Ferndale pilot. Read the shared constants instead and respect them in your batching logic. For reference, the current scheduler constants are these.

tuning table, yajog-yahof:
BUDGETS = {
    "lamvan": 303,
    "wenox": 460,
    "fenvan": 525,
}

Subject: Marketing budget trim — what it means for branches

Hi all,

Quick note before the exec review: we're cutting Novaquill's marketing budget by roughly 15% next quarter. Branch-level co-op funds are mostly safe, but the Lanterno sponsorship and the Eastvale radio spots are gone. Dario Fenn will circulate revised targets by Friday. Please don't share beyond this group yet — staff comms come next week. The confidential context sits just below.

management briefing: The renewal with Quenathox Group closes at $10 million a year, 20 percent below the last contract. Project Ulawyn slips by two quarters because of the supplier delay.